Pre-op procedures

Hello,

I am in the process of having the lap-band surgery. I am scheduled to have my sleep apnea evaluation. Can anyone tell me what the next step is after this evaluation? The suspense is killing me because I want to hurry up and get this surgery over with. The process is entirely to long.

Hi, I agree the process is way too long, I started this journey on Aug. 12 of this year, my sleep evaluation was the last thing i had to do. I did psych test, ekg, blood work, and met with a nutritionist now I am just waiting to meet with the doctor to sign my ins. papers off. That appt. is on Oct. 30. It seems like it will take about 4 months depending on how long my ins. wait to give the approval, but everyone's is different.
